This shoe was a third purchase after two returns of other new balance football boots. 13 wide was too small. However, 13.5 wide was a perfect fit for me. I don't normally wear wide shoes but it was necessary for these boots. My everyday shoes are wide toe box minimalist shoes in size 13. The half a size was perfect.On the pitch, the boots perform great. I would have preferred full leather boots but this synthetic material was good. It feels real good kicking, receiving, and passing. They are also really comfortable both sprinting and running. I'm really happy with these boots.
I have bought the Adidas Mundial Team turf shoes for several years now because they were the only ones that stood up to the beating I put on my turf shoes. However, their width designation is D which means medium as anyone that has wide feet knows and that means my foot is not fully supported by the sole. I usually wear a 4E which is extra wide so D is a far cry from 4E as there is E, 2E, 3E, then 4E in width categories. These particular shoes are a 2E designation. I figured I would try them even if they were not kangaroo leather. Kangaroo leather is the best in cleats for softness and stretching to feet width. I have played two games in these shoes so far and I have found a viable replacement for the Adidas shoes I have always worn. Ordered 12 Wide (2E), but the shoes are too short and narrow. The length is not true to size and the Wide 2E order is super narrow. Strangely, the rubber sole is very narrow, it appears that a slightly wider upper was stitched onto a standard or narrow rubber sole. Weird that the instep on the shoe is significantly wider than the sole. Not a good design overall. For perspective, I ordered a the 696v4 tennis shoes in the same size and width at the same time. The tennis shoes are true to size and width, massively wider than the 442v2 soccer shoes. The tennis shoes in the same 12 2E size appear to be an inch longer and perhaps 1/2" wider.
This the only turf shoe I was able to find that would accommodate my short and wide feet. I tried both Adidas and Nike and even the models that were recommended for wide feet felt way too narrow for me. After a lot of trial and error, I was able to find a comfortable combination for play; Currex CleatPro insole and Tabio or WeFoot thin grip socks.Pros:"Wide" widthRemovable insoleCons:May still be too narrow for someColorways are pretty generic
